Post by Doo on Mar 6, 2019 22:59:51 GMT -5
This is a cool idea, but a few concerns with this: 1. Some people might not want others to know what they're doing. Not that anyone would be doing anything that they weren't supposed to, but I could see a scenario where someone used the feature to follow a person around in a creepy way to see everything they're doing. Plus some people just prefer the privacy to do what they want.
2. This might be a problem in terms of people feeling frustrated/jealousy if they see that someone is viewing their post/reply to them but not responding. I know sometimes I'll look at a post or reply to me that I want to respond to, but don't have the time immediately when I see it. Or I might want to wait to give a more detailed response. I just wouldn't want anyone to feel bad or jealous.
3. There might be an issue with personal messages too. I know people use personal messages in different ways, some people don't use it at all and others use it to have extensive conversations with members in private. I wouldn't want anyone to feel frustrated or jealous if they see someone's activity is regularly responding to a specific person (i.e. they might think "this person's activity says they're always talking to so and so via PM. Why don't they PM me as much as they do this other person?") I'm not really sure how other people use the PM function, but honestly there are a couple people on here who I'll talk to via PM a lot or write longer messages to,, just to chat about life and stuff. Point being I just wouldn't want anyone to feel jealous if someone's talking to another person privately a lot and they see it via this potential new feature.
I'm definitely not opposed to it, though those are my concerns at the moment. Do you have any thoughts on these? There is a feature, if you click on a specific board, it will show the members names that are also viewing the same board that you are at that time.
